    Southern Tier 2XMas tastes like a spiced, malty fruit cake. A nice treat, but not something to have all season long. Rogue Santa's Reserve is always good, and very drinkable, as is 21st Century Amendment's Fireside Chat. I look for those two each year, and am looking forward t finding a new favorite this year.
